134 lines
4.3 KiB
TypeScript
134 lines
4.3 KiB
TypeScript
/**
|
|
* Table schema of the `users_sync` table used by Neon Auth.
|
|
* This table automatically synchronizes and stores user data from external authentication providers.
|
|
*
|
|
* @schema neon_auth
|
|
* @table users_sync
|
|
*/
|
|
export declare const usersSync: import("../pg-core/index.js").PgTableWithColumns<{
|
|
name: "users_sync";
|
|
schema: "neon_auth";
|
|
columns: {
|
|
rawJson: import("../pg-core/index.js").PgColumn<{
|
|
name: "raw_json";
|
|
tableName: "users_sync";
|
|
dataType: "json";
|
|
columnType: "PgJsonb";
|
|
data: unknown;
|
|
driverParam: unknown;
|
|
notNull: true;
|
|
hasDefault: false;
|
|
isPrimaryKey: false;
|
|
isAutoincrement: false;
|
|
hasRuntimeDefault: false;
|
|
enumValues: undefined;
|
|
baseColumn: never;
|
|
identity: undefined;
|
|
generated: undefined;
|
|
}, {}, {}>;
|
|
id: import("../pg-core/index.js").PgColumn<{
|
|
name: "id";
|
|
tableName: "users_sync";
|
|
dataType: "string";
|
|
columnType: "PgText";
|
|
data: string;
|
|
driverParam: string;
|
|
notNull: true;
|
|
hasDefault: false;
|
|
isPrimaryKey: true;
|
|
isAutoincrement: false;
|
|
hasRuntimeDefault: false;
|
|
enumValues: [string, ...string[]];
|
|
baseColumn: never;
|
|
identity: undefined;
|
|
generated: undefined;
|
|
}, {}, {}>;
|
|
name: import("../pg-core/index.js").PgColumn<{
|
|
name: "name";
|
|
tableName: "users_sync";
|
|
dataType: "string";
|
|
columnType: "PgText";
|
|
data: string;
|
|
driverParam: string;
|
|
notNull: false;
|
|
hasDefault: false;
|
|
isPrimaryKey: false;
|
|
isAutoincrement: false;
|
|
hasRuntimeDefault: false;
|
|
enumValues: [string, ...string[]];
|
|
baseColumn: never;
|
|
identity: undefined;
|
|
generated: undefined;
|
|
}, {}, {}>;
|
|
email: import("../pg-core/index.js").PgColumn<{
|
|
name: "email";
|
|
tableName: "users_sync";
|
|
dataType: "string";
|
|
columnType: "PgText";
|
|
data: string;
|
|
driverParam: string;
|
|
notNull: false;
|
|
hasDefault: false;
|
|
isPrimaryKey: false;
|
|
isAutoincrement: false;
|
|
hasRuntimeDefault: false;
|
|
enumValues: [string, ...string[]];
|
|
baseColumn: never;
|
|
identity: undefined;
|
|
generated: undefined;
|
|
}, {}, {}>;
|
|
createdAt: import("../pg-core/index.js").PgColumn<{
|
|
name: "created_at";
|
|
tableName: "users_sync";
|
|
dataType: "string";
|
|
columnType: "PgTimestampString";
|
|
data: string;
|
|
driverParam: string;
|
|
notNull: false;
|
|
hasDefault: false;
|
|
isPrimaryKey: false;
|
|
isAutoincrement: false;
|
|
hasRuntimeDefault: false;
|
|
enumValues: undefined;
|
|
baseColumn: never;
|
|
identity: undefined;
|
|
generated: undefined;
|
|
}, {}, {}>;
|
|
deletedAt: import("../pg-core/index.js").PgColumn<{
|
|
name: "deleted_at";
|
|
tableName: "users_sync";
|
|
dataType: "string";
|
|
columnType: "PgTimestampString";
|
|
data: string;
|
|
driverParam: string;
|
|
notNull: false;
|
|
hasDefault: false;
|
|
isPrimaryKey: false;
|
|
isAutoincrement: false;
|
|
hasRuntimeDefault: false;
|
|
enumValues: undefined;
|
|
baseColumn: never;
|
|
identity: undefined;
|
|
generated: undefined;
|
|
}, {}, {}>;
|
|
updatedAt: import("../pg-core/index.js").PgColumn<{
|
|
name: "updated_at";
|
|
tableName: "users_sync";
|
|
dataType: "string";
|
|
columnType: "PgTimestampString";
|
|
data: string;
|
|
driverParam: string;
|
|
notNull: false;
|
|
hasDefault: false;
|
|
isPrimaryKey: false;
|
|
isAutoincrement: false;
|
|
hasRuntimeDefault: false;
|
|
enumValues: undefined;
|
|
baseColumn: never;
|
|
identity: undefined;
|
|
generated: undefined;
|
|
}, {}, {}>;
|
|
};
|
|
dialect: "pg";
|
|
}>;
|